The Pearl Rainbow Warrior Tungsten Bead has become a top selling fly in our retail location and we are proud to offer it here. The thorax of this fly is rainbow dubbing which is a blend of different colors. We feel some of the reasons this fly is so productive is at least one of the colors will stand out in any fishing condition and the abdomen closely matches a midge pupa. The Rainbow Warrior works in almost any water but is hard to beat when fish are feeding on midges. This pattern works well in waters with sow bugs and will also work for a Mysis shrimp. The extra weight of the tungsten head makes this fly sink fast and makes this fly a great choice to trail off of a dry.

The Gold Sparkle Pupa Emerger Fly is the result of closely observing hatching caddis flies in underwater environments. It is an unconventional but effective fish catcher. The antron case is supposed to imitate the gas bubbles used by hatching flies to propel them to the surface. Whether or not this is accurate trout seem to inhale this fly when caddis are hatching. It can be fished with a dead drift, twitched, or swung. Different colors and sizes allow the angler to match the local caddisflies.

The Partridge Post Parachute Callibaetis is both a realistic imitation of an adult callibaetis mayfly and, at the same time, is visible for anglers. Casting to cruising gulpers on big lakes or slow moving rivers where Callibaetis are abundant is an absolute blast and the Partridge Post Callibaetis is as close to a sure thing as you get for imitating these lake hatching mayflies.
